Edatabase error
montei um program e quando eu vou incluir um item ele dá o seguinte erro:
Project Sisloja.exe raised exception class EDatabaseError with message
´Field ´PEDIDO´ cannot be modified´. Process stopped. Use step or run to continue...
o que pode ser...? USO PARADOX E TTABLE
Project Sisloja.exe raised exception class EDatabaseError with message
´Field ´PEDIDO´ cannot be modified´. Process stopped. Use step or run to continue...
o que pode ser...? USO PARADOX E TTABLE
Rafael Santana
Curtidas 0
Respostas
Lucas Silva
25/08/2004
Erro do banco de Dados...
O campo pedido não pode ser modificado!
O campo pedido não pode ser modificado!
GOSTEI 0
Carlosrm
25/08/2004
rafael,
explicitando mais um pouco, seguindo a explicação do Lucas:
verifique se o seu campo Pedido ( na definição da tabela ) é do tipo Autoincremento. Se for, é possível que no seu código, em algum momento, (num Post, por exemplo), você esteja atribuindo algum valor para esse campo. Se for Autoincremento, o campo Pedido não poderá ser alterado pelo seu código ou pelo usuário. É o próprio Paradox que altera este campo, automaticamente, aumentando em 1 a cada novo registro gravado.
carlosrm
explicitando mais um pouco, seguindo a explicação do Lucas:
verifique se o seu campo Pedido ( na definição da tabela ) é do tipo Autoincremento. Se for, é possível que no seu código, em algum momento, (num Post, por exemplo), você esteja atribuindo algum valor para esse campo. Se for Autoincremento, o campo Pedido não poderá ser alterado pelo seu código ou pelo usuário. É o próprio Paradox que altera este campo, automaticamente, aumentando em 1 a cada novo registro gravado.
carlosrm
GOSTEI 0